16.1 分层架构(Controller-Service-Repository)


文档摘要

16.1 分层架构(Controller-Service-Repository) 第十六章:架构演进与工程化实践 16.1 分层架构(Controller-Service-Repository) 在现代 Web 应用开发中,架构设计不再仅仅是功能实现的附属品,而是决定系统可维护性、可扩展性乃至业务可持续演进的核心骨架。Nest.js 作为一款深受 Angular 启发、基于 TypeScript 构建的渐进式 Node.js 框架,其对分层架构的天然支持,使其成为企业级后端系统构建的理想选择。而在众多架构范式中,“Controller-Service-Repository”三层结构因其清晰的职责分离、良好的测试边界和高度的工程化适应性,被广泛采纳为 Nest.js 项目的标准组织模式。


发布者: 作者: 转发
评论区 (0)
U